CCEMS and its employees shall comply with the <br />non - disclosure and other requirements of all applicable laws and regulations with respect <br />to these confidential student records. <br />• CCBOE and CCEMS agree to compliance with the Health Insurance Portability and <br />Accountability of Act (HIPAA) for protection of patient privacy and non - disclosure. <br />Cabarrus County School's EMS Program Responsibilities <br />• Assign students to program with interest in public safety. <br />• CCS shall make available appropriate instructors or preceptors for the student clinical and <br />educational experiences consistent with NCOEMS requirements. <br />• Submit clinical schedule requests to CCEMS EMS Liaison with student information and <br />instructor contact information. Clinical requests will include student name and time of <br />attendance. <br />• CCS understands that the number of students for clinical experiences will be one (1) per <br />unit. The number of students permitted daily for clinical experience is dependent upon <br />availability of units and CCEMS preceptors. <br />• CCS will provide clinical objectives to the student and CCEMS. <br />• CCS shall perform frequent didactic and practical examinations to ensure proficiency and <br />safety to patients and staff in accordance with standards of care acceptable to CCEMS. <br />• CCS will maintain adequate equipment for student on -site educational experiences. <br />• CCS will make available uniforms for student wear during clinical and educational <br />experiences. <br />• CCS EMTTPC must maintain NCOEMS Level I Instructor Credential for the EMT <br />Level. <br />• A NCOEMS Level II Instructor for the EMT level must be assigned for program <br />oversight and certification of scope of practice testing. <br />• CCS will require EMT II students to complete twenty four (24) hours ride time during the <br />school year. EMT I students may be allowed to complete ride time but are not required. <br />• CCS will schedule students who meet NCOEMS requirements for the NCOEMS EMT <br />credentialing examination within six months of program graduation. <br />• CCS will maintain communication with assigned NCOEMS Level II Instructor and the <br />CCEMS EMS Liaison. <br />• CCS will provide infection control training prior to clinical assignments. <br />• CCS will provide for the verification of required vaccinations prior to clinical <br />assignments. <br />• CCS will maintain or provide for the procurement of professional liability insurance for <br />students. <br />• CCS will only permit students to provide care outside of clinical rotations that are <br />currently certified in CPR and First Aid by the American Heart Association or American <br />Red Cross. <br />Cabarrus County EMS Responsibilities <br />CCEMS shall provide clinical opportunities during the hours of 0800 -2200 hours seven <br />days weekly pending availability of units and preceptors. <br />Attachment number 1 <br />F -4 Page 109 <br />
